ONYX - Fibre
Product Description
The high-performance ONYX Series Fibre Routing Switcher is suited for environments that use fibre to carry complete end-to-end digital video and audio. Switching sizes range from 8×8 to 128×128. It supports data rates up to 3.2Gbps.
The switcher is modular designed. Each slot can hold one FOB-8 Module (8 Channel I/O Module) with eight LC connectors. The switcher is compatible with both Multi-Mode (MM) and Single-Mode (SM). MM supports multi-mode fibre (MMF) of 850nm wavelength for transmission distance up to 500 ft (approx 150 m). SM supports single-mode fibre (SMF) of 1310nm wavelength for transmission distance up to 98360 ft (30 km). SM also supports MMF.
The switcher supports By-Pass. It is controlled through the local front panel or the supporting control applications for normal switching. However, if there is a channel problem or Cross-Point Switching Module failure, it can perform point-to-point by-pass protection for input to that channel or for all inputs. Thus the program output can be maintained, ensuring system safety and reliability.
Multiple control interfaces include RS-232/422, TCP/IP, CAN and C-BUS. Three frame versions are available: 2RU, 4RU and 8RU. ONYX Series Fibre Routing Switcher supports redundant control and power supply
